In modern industrial manufacturing, metal stamping and custom metal fabrication serve as the foundational bedrock for sectors ranging from automotive and aerospace to telecommunications and medical technology. As global supply chains undergo rapid structural changes due to geopolitical dynamics and fluctuating shipping costs, procurement professionals are shifting their focus from "lowest nominal unit cost" to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) and supply chain resilience.

Rather than acting as a simple sheet metal puncher, XinYe provides a complete system of metallurgical and mechanical production methods. We analyze product designs to suggest the optimal manufacturing routing—whether it requires stamping, forging, casting, or final precision CNC machining.
Utilizing high-speed progressive presses from 5 tons to 250 tons, we handle thin-gauge steel, aluminum, copper, and specialized plastics. Our deep drawing lines support extreme height-to-diameter aspect ratios for hermetic casings and deep industrial enclosures.
Leveraging friction press equipment with force ranges from 300 to 1000 tons, along with column hydraulic presses from 100 to 630 tons. Hot forging yields superior grain flow, eliminating internal voids and maximizing fatigue life for critical aerospace and automotive transmission parts.
Equipped with high-precision 4-axis Japanese imports and advanced CNC milling and turning centers. We hold strict dimensional tolerances down to ±0.001mm, allowing post-machining on forged, cast, or stamped parts for precision fits.
Providing precision investment casting for complex, organic components that cannot be stamped or forged. Supports a wide range of stainless steel grades, delivering thin-walled, geometrically complex components.
Comprehensive in-house finishing lines, including anodizing (clear and color), electro-polishing, passivation, sandblasting, and powder coating, ensuring compliance with salt spray resistance requirements.

From preliminary drawing review to dynamic after-sales validation.
Customers submit their preliminary engineering drawings (STEP/IGS/DWG format). Our R&D and engineering teams review the design to ensure metal formability, optimal material utilization, and tooling suitability.
We source raw materials matching the target chemistry specifications. Custom sample tooling is machined to produce dynamic samples. These samples undergo coordinate measurement and material composition verification, and the corresponding reports are sent to the client.
The client tests the sample parts in their actual application. Based on real-world fit, function, and clearance requirements, dimensional adjustments are integrated into the final production tooling model.
Upon final prototype approval, mass production is initiated. We employ progressive quality gates throughout stamping, hot forging, or machining operations to maintain batch-to-batch consistency.
Parts are packaged using rust-preventative coatings, barrier foils, and shock-resistant custom crates. We offer a one-year manufacturing warranty from the date of receipt, providing ongoing engineering support for all client orders.
